Banking market profile · FDIC Summary of Deposits, June 30, 2025

Adams County, Pennsylvania, a core county of the Harrisburg-York-Lebanon, PA market, holds $1.8B in deposits across 4 insured institutions and 17 branches. ACNB Bank is the largest deposit holder at 60.8% share. The top three institutions hold 96.5% of deposits, which places the county in the concentrated band. Deposits have grown 7.5% since 2020 while the branch count fell by 7. It produces $3.6B of output, ranking #712 of the 1,523 counties within a CSA or MSA by economic output.

Branches: 24 in 2020 to 17 in 2025. Institutions: 4 to 4. Top-three share: 94.6% to 96.5%.

The 4 insured institutions with a branch presence in this county, as of June 30, 2025. Five-year change compares the same institution’s county deposits in 2020 and 2025. Institutions are tracked by FDIC certificate number, and where an institution acquired another bank, the acquired bank’s prior deposits are folded into the baseline so the change reflects the combined, continuing franchise rather than reading as new. Even so, a large gain can reflect acquisition rather than competitive growth; “no 2020 presence” means neither the institution nor a bank it later absorbed reported deposits in this county that year.

Part of the Harrisburg-York-Lebanon market

Adams County is one of 6 counties that make up the Harrisburg-York-Lebanon, PA market, a Combined Statistical Area (ranked #52 of 293 U.S. markets by economic output). It produces 4.9% of the market’s output and holds 5.1% of its deposits.
